在使用 Shadowsocks 的过程中,用户可能会遇到一条提示信息:“unexpected error shadowsocks will exit”。这个错误通常意味着 Shadowsocks 无法正常启动或运行,并且会导致其自动退出。本文将探讨这一问题的原因、解决方法以及常见问题解答。
什么是Shadowsocks?
Shadowsocks 是一种流行的代理工具,它通过建立加密的代理连接,帮助用户绕过网络审查,访问被限制的网站。它在许多地区被广泛使用,尤其是在那些互联网审查严格的国家。
出现“unexpected error shadowsocks will exit”的原因
导致 Shadowsocks 出现“unexpected error shadowsocks will exit”错误的原因可能有很多,常见的包括:
- 配置文件错误:配置文件中的参数设置不正确,或者文件格式有误。
- 网络连接问题:无法连接到代理服务器,可能是由于网络不稳定或服务器宕机。
- 软件版本不兼容:使用了过期或不兼容的 Shadowsocks 客户端版本。
- 防火墙或安全软件干扰:某些防火墙或安全软件可能会阻止 Shadowsocks 的运行。
解决“unexpected error shadowsocks will exit”问题的方法
针对上述原因,可以尝试以下解决方法:
1. 检查配置文件
- 确保配置文件中各项参数正确无误,特别是服务器地址、端口和密码等信息。
- 确保配置文件的格式符合 Shadowsocks 的要求,建议使用 JSON 格式。
2. 确认网络连接
- 测试网络连接是否正常,尝试访问其他网站确认网络通畅。
- 检查代理服务器是否在线,您可以尝试更换其他可用的服务器。
3. 更新Shadowsocks客户端
- 下载并安装最新版本的 Shadowsocks 客户端,确保您的软件是最新的。
- 删除旧版本的客户端后重新安装,以防止文件冲突。
4. 检查防火墙设置
- 查看系统防火墙设置,确保 Shadowsocks 的相关程序没有被阻止。
- 如果使用了安全软件,尝试暂时禁用或添加 Shadowsocks 到白名单中。
常见问题解答(FAQ)
Q1: 为什么我的Shadowsocks总是退出?
A1: 如果 Shadowsocks 总是退出,首先检查配置文件是否正确,网络连接是否正常。必要时尝试重启软件或设备,更新客户端,或更换代理服务器。
Q2: 如何找到正确的Shadowsocks服务器?
A2: 可以通过在线论坛、社交媒体群组或技术博客等途径找到推荐的 Shadowsocks 服务器。确保选择信誉好的服务提供商。
Q3: Shadowsocks有替代方案吗?
A3: 是的,存在多种替代方案,例如 V2Ray、WireGuard 和 Trojan 等,用户可以根据需要进行选择。
Q4: 是否可以在手机上使用Shadowsocks?
A4: 是的,Shadowsocks 提供移动端的客户端,支持 Android 和 iOS 系统,用户只需在相应的应用商店下载即可。
Q5: Shadowsocks的使用是否安全?
A5: Shadowsocks 提供了加密的连接,但用户仍需注意数据隐私,建议搭配使用 VPN 等其他安全措施以提高安全性。
总结
遇到“unexpected error shadowsocks will exit”的问题并不罕见,通过以上方法,用户通常可以找到合适的解决方案,恢复 Shadowsocks 的正常使用。保持软件更新,定期检查配置及网络连接,将有助于避免类似问题的发生。